IDLV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

120 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Invesco S&P International Developed Low Volatility ETF (IDLV)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$474M — up 2% from $465M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 28 funds opened new IDLV positions and 7 closed out — a net gain of 21 holders — while 47 added to existing stakes and 29 trimmed.

The largest buyer was LPL Financial, adding an estimated $19.3M. The largest seller was PFS Investments, exiting entirely with an estimated $46.9M sold.
